#36278f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#36278f is composed of 21.2% red, 15.3%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.2% cyan, 72.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 248.7 degrees, a saturation of 57.1% and a lightness of 35.7%. #36278f color hex could be obtained by blending #6c4eff with #00001f.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

Shades and Tints of #36278f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020104 is the darkest color, while #f5f4fc is the lightest one.
